Solar Hot Water Heater Made from Beer Bottles

Ma Yanjun, a Chinese farmer in Shaanxi province, invented a rooftop solar hot water heater by connecting a bunch of beer bottles with some tubing. He says it heats enough water for his whole family to get a daily hot shower. It must work because ten other families in the village have already copied his design.
